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_001040424.3(PRDM15):​c.2924C>T​(p.Ala975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000479 in 1,461,820 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
PRDM15 (HGNC:13999): (PR/SET domain 15) Predicted to enable DNA-binding transcription activator activity, RNA polymerase II-specific; RNA polymerase II cis-regulatory region sequence-specific DNA binding activity; and promoter-specific chromatin binding activity. Predicted to be involved in positive regulation of transcription by RNA polymerase II; regulation of signal transduction; and regulation of stem cell division. Located in nuclear body.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 30, 2024The c.4022C>T (p.A1341V) alteration is located in exon 30 (coding exon 30) of the PRDM15 gene. This alteration results from a C to T substitution at nucleotide position 4022, causing the alanine (A) at amino acid position 1341 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
